Bow-Image-Classification

Author: Sarang Galada
Email ID: [email protected]
Date created: 26/12/2023

Description: Classification of Bow (weapon) images scraped from the web into 5 types using Transfer-learning and Fine-tuning of 3 popular CNNs - ResNet50V2, InceptionV3 and DenseNet121. Finally the best performing fine-tuned models of each are ensembled with majority-rule voting Results: Achieved a maximum accuracy and weighted-F1-score of 0.91, with 10 epochs of training on a bootstrapped dataset of 810 images

  • Problem: Image Classification
  • Data: Bow (weapon) Images
  • Models: ResNet50V2, InceptionV3, DenseNet121
  • Key libraries used: TensorFlow Keras, PIL, Scikit-Learn
